The training you will be getting
Level 3 Business Administrator Apprenticeship.
This programme allows students to develop their skills, knowledge and behaviours through the practical period at college as well as in the workplace doing on the job training. The role overview of a Business Administrator Apprentice would be supporting and engaging with different parts of the organisation and interact with internal or external customers.
Duration & start date:
This is a full-time 18-month apprenticeship (15 months for the practical period which includes the day release at college and 3 months for the end point assessment). Potential career progression opportunities are available upon completion

Adjustments for experience
You could reduce your training time, or finish your apprenticeship faster, if you have relevant prior learning or experience. This could be relevant:
- training
- qualifications, like an NVQ in a relevant field
- industry or sector experience
